A beaker is filled with water up to its brim. A child while playing drops an object of mass 5 kg in to it and measured the weight of water falling. He found the weight of water fallen to be 20N, then choose the correct statement.

Solution

The correct option is B

The buoyant force exerted by water is equal to 20 N


According to Archimedes Principle, when a body is partially or totally immersed in a liquid, it experiences a buoyant force which is equal to the weight of the liquid displaced. So, when the block is immersed it would experience a buoyant force, which would be equal to the weight of liquid displaced. Here, the weight of the displaced liquid is given 20N. So, buoyant force is equal to 20N.
